Who knew that the little area known as “Pleasant View” across the river would someday become host to the most notable projects in Jackson County. On Nov 14, 1890 the area east of Black River Falls known as Pleasant View became an official Wisconsin Township. The township would extend east of the Black River carving out a corridor between Hawk Island Road to the south and Sand Pillow Road to the north until finally coming together with the majestic Black River Forest.
